Proper Treatment of Hyperpigmentation After IPL?
On my second IPL treatment, my left and right cheeks got burned. The doctor told me to apply some steroid cream. After 2 weeks, part of my cheek became brown and looks like birth mark. I showed it to her and she did a slight peel to lighten it up. Is this the proper way of treating pigmentation after IPL? Is this something that can be reversed?

If IPL caused your pigmentation
One good thing about the face is that it heals remarkably well (and faster than any other part of the body except for the scalp). If you have pigmenation caused by being burned by a laser (or IPL), it usually goes away. Conservative treatment works best. Use a bleaching cream, avoid the sun and give it a few weeks (or sometimes months) and it should completely resolve.
